Output ef23397a6e5e9292cba4bf2324f2424a0c427ae6ea4c07c9fda350275b7e338a:24

value
33676885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 236207e9e94c6ca967a3f6bcdaefeffd9b0ee528 OP_EQUAL
address
MB8FKT95jsXh2ubfFmka3y7S167Q1n57x6
transaction
ef23397a6e5e9292cba4bf2324f2424a0c427ae6ea4c07c9fda350275b7e338a
spent
true